Industrial roof replacement services involve removing an existing roof structure and installing a new roofing system on commercial or industrial properties. This process typically includes thorough inspection, preparation of the roof deck, and the installation of new roofing materials suited to the specific needs of the property. Contractors focus on ensuring the new roof provides durability, weather resistance, and structural integrity, often utilizing advanced materials to meet the demands of large-scale facilities.
These services address common issues such as roof leaks, extensive wear and tear, or damage caused by severe weather conditions. Over time, exposure to the elements can weaken roofing materials, leading to increased energy costs and potential interior damage. Replacing an aging or compromised roof helps prevent costly repairs, improves energy efficiency, and enhances the safety of the building’s occupants and contents.
Properties that typically require industrial roof replacement include warehouses, manufacturing plants, distribution centers, and large retail facilities. These structures often have expansive roof surfaces that are subject to constant use and environmental exposure. Properly replacing the roof on such properties is essential for maintaining operational efficiency and protecting valuable assets stored inside. Industrial roof replacement services are tailored to accommodate the unique size, design, and functional requirements of these types of properties.
Professional contractors providing industrial roof replacement services often work with a variety of roofing systems, including metal, TPO, EPDM, and built-up roofing. They assess the specific conditions of each property to recommend the most suitable materials and installation methods. Material Costs - The cost of roofing materials for industrial roof replacement typically ranges from $3 to $10 per square foot. For example, a 10,000-square-foot roof may cost between $30,000 and $100,000 for materials alone, depending on the type selected.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for replacing an industrial roof usually fall between $2 and $5 per square foot. For a large project, this could mean $20,000 to $50,000 in labor fees for a 10,000-square-foot roof.
Removal and Disposal - Removing and disposing of the old roofing can add $1 to $3 per square foot to the total cost. For a 10,000-square-foot roof, this expense might range from $10,000 to $30,000.
Additional Factors - Costs can vary based on roof complexity, height, and accessibility, often adding 10-20% to the overall project budget. Contact local service providers to obtain precise estimates tailored to specific industrial roof replacement need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the signs that an industrial roof needs replacement? Indicators include persistent leaks, extensive visible damage, or roof material deterioration that cannot be repaired effectively.
How long does an industrial roof replacement typically take? The duration varies depending on the size and complexity of the project, but local contractors can provide estimates based on specific building requirements.
What types of roofing materials are commonly used for industrial roof replacements? Common options include metal, built-up roofing (BUR), modified bitumen, and single-ply membranes, selected based on durability and building needs.
Is it necessary to vacate the building during roof replacement? It depends on the scope of work; some projects may require temporary evacuation for safety reasons, while others can be completed with minimal disruption.
